Package com.zebra.scannercontrol
Enum DCSSDKDefs.DCSSDK_BT_PROTOCOL
- java.lang.Object
-
- java.lang.Enum<DCSSDKDefs.DCSSDK_BT_PROTOCOL>
-
- com.zebra.scannercontrol.DCSSDKDefs.DCSSDK_BT_PROTOCOL
-
- All Implemented Interfaces:
java.io.Serializable
,java.lang.Comparable<DCSSDKDefs.DCSSDK_BT_PROTOCOL>
- Enclosing class:
- DCSSDKDefs
public static enum DCSSDKDefs.DCSSDK_BT_PROTOCOL extends java.lang.Enum<DCSSDKDefs.DCSSDK_BT_PROTOCOL>
Bluetooth Protocol to be used in pairing barcode. Legacy B format will not change the scanners com protocol.
-
-
Enum Constant Summary
Enum Constants Enum Constant Description CRD_BT
Cradle - Classic BluetoothCRD_BT_LE
Cradle - Low Energy BluetoothHID_BT
Human Interface Device (HID) Keyboard BT ClassicHID_BT_LE
Human Interface Device (HID) Keyboard BT LE (Discoverable)LEGACY_B
No change in scanner host mode.SPP_BT_MASTER
Serial Port Profile (SPP) BT Classic (Non-Discoverable)SPP_BT_SLAVE
Serial Port Profile (SPP) BT Classic (Discoverable)SSI_BT_CRADLE_HOST
Simple Serial Interface (SSI) BT Classic (Non-Discoverable)SSI_BT_LE
Simple Serial Interface (SSI) BT Low energySSI_BT_MFI
Simple Serial Interface (SSI) BT with MFi (iOS Support)SSI_BT_SSI_SLAVE
Simple Serial Interface (SSI) BT Classic (Discoverable)
-
Field Summary
Fields Modifier and Type Field Description int
value
-
Method Summary
All Methods Static Methods Concrete Methods Modifier and Type Method Description static DCSSDKDefs.DCSSDK_BT_PROTOCOL
valueOf(java.lang.String name)
Returns the enum constant of this type with the specified name.static DCSSDKDefs.DCSSDK_BT_PROTOCOL[]
values()
Returns an array containing the constants of this enum type, in the order they are declared.
-
-
-
Enum Constant Detail
-
SSI_BT_CRADLE_HOST
public static final DCSSDKDefs.DCSSDK_BT_PROTOCOL SSI_BT_CRADLE_HOST
Simple Serial Interface (SSI) BT Classic (Non-Discoverable)
-
SSI_BT_SSI_SLAVE
public static final DCSSDKDefs.DCSSDK_BT_PROTOCOL SSI_BT_SSI_SLAVE
Simple Serial Interface (SSI) BT Classic (Discoverable)
-
SSI_BT_LE
public static final DCSSDKDefs.DCSSDK_BT_PROTOCOL SSI_BT_LE
Simple Serial Interface (SSI) BT Low energy
-
SSI_BT_MFI
public static final DCSSDKDefs.DCSSDK_BT_PROTOCOL SSI_BT_MFI
Simple Serial Interface (SSI) BT with MFi (iOS Support)
-
CRD_BT
public static final DCSSDKDefs.DCSSDK_BT_PROTOCOL CRD_BT
Cradle - Classic Bluetooth
-
CRD_BT_LE
public static final DCSSDKDefs.DCSSDK_BT_PROTOCOL CRD_BT_LE
Cradle - Low Energy Bluetooth
-
HID_BT
public static final DCSSDKDefs.DCSSDK_BT_PROTOCOL HID_BT
Human Interface Device (HID) Keyboard BT Classic
-
HID_BT_LE
public static final DCSSDKDefs.DCSSDK_BT_PROTOCOL HID_BT_LE
Human Interface Device (HID) Keyboard BT LE (Discoverable)
-
SPP_BT_MASTER
public static final DCSSDKDefs.DCSSDK_BT_PROTOCOL SPP_BT_MASTER
Serial Port Profile (SPP) BT Classic (Non-Discoverable)
-
SPP_BT_SLAVE
public static final DCSSDKDefs.DCSSDK_BT_PROTOCOL SPP_BT_SLAVE
Serial Port Profile (SPP) BT Classic (Discoverable)
-
LEGACY_B
public static final DCSSDKDefs.DCSSDK_BT_PROTOCOL LEGACY_B
No change in scanner host mode. Only paring information.
-
-
Method Detail
-
values
public static DCSSDKDefs.DCSSDK_BT_PROTOCOL[] values()
Returns an array containing the constants of this enum type, in the order they are declared. This method may be used to iterate over the constants as follows:for (DCSSDKDefs.DCSSDK_BT_PROTOCOL c : DCSSDKDefs.DCSSDK_BT_PROTOCOL.values()) System.out.println(c);
- Returns:
- an array containing the constants of this enum type, in the order they are declared
-
valueOf
public static DCSSDKDefs.DCSSDK_BT_PROTOCOL valueOf(java.lang.String name)
Returns the enum constant of this type with the specified name. The string must match exactly an identifier used to declare an enum constant in this type. (Extraneous whitespace characters are not permitted.)- Parameters:
name
- the name of the enum constant to be returned.- Returns:
- the enum constant with the specified name
- Throws:
java.lang.IllegalArgumentException
- if this enum type has no constant with the specified namejava.lang.NullPointerException
- if the argument is null
-
-